.hero[data-astro-cid-hmgcfoij] h1[data-astro-cid-hmgcfoij]{margin-bottom:.45rem}.hero[data-astro-cid-hmgcfoij] p[data-astro-cid-hmgcfoij]{margin:0;color:var(--muted)}.quarter-grid[data-astro-cid-hmgcfoij]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:.85rem}.fiscal-intro[data-astro-cid-hmgcfoij] p[data-astro-cid-hmgcfoij],.fiscal-election[data-astro-cid-hmgcfoij] p[data-astro-cid-hmgcfoij]{line-height:1.7;color:var(--muted)}.fiscal-intro[data-astro-cid-hmgcfoij] p[data-astro-cid-hmgcfoij]+p[data-astro-cid-hmgcfoij],.fiscal-election[data-astro-cid-hmgcfoij] p[data-astro-cid-hmgcfoij]+p[data-astro-cid-hmgcfoij]{margin-top:.6rem}.fiscal-intro[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ij],.fiscal-election[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]{color:var(--accent);text-decoration:none}.fiscal-intro[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:hover,.fiscal-intro[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:focus-visible,.fiscal-election[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:hover,.fiscal-election[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:focus-visible{text-decoration:underline}.election-list[data-astro-cid-hmgcfoij]{margin:.6rem 0;padding-left:1.2rem;color:var(--muted);line-height:1.7}.election-list[data-astro-cid-hmgcfoij] li[data-astro-cid-hmgcfoij]{margin-bottom:.35rem}.cross-links[data-astro-cid-hmgcfoij] h2[data-astro-cid-hmgcfoij]{margin-bottom:.65rem}.cross-links[data-astro-cid-hmgcfoij] ul[data-astro-cid-hmgcfoij]{margin:0;padding:0;list-style:none;display:flex;flex-wrap:wrap;gap:.5rem}.cross-links[data-astro-cid-hmgcfoij] li[data-astro-cid-hmgcfoij]{border:1px solid var(--line);border-radius:.72rem;padding:.45rem .85rem;background:color-mix(in oklab,var(--surface-strong) 90%,transparent)}.cross-links[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]{color:var(--accent);text-decoration:none;font-weight:500}.cross-links[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:hover,.cross-links[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:focus-visible{text-decoration:underline}.faq-panel[data-astro-cid-hmgcfoij] h2[data-astro-cid-hmgcfoij]{margin-bottom:.8rem}details[data-astro-cid-hmgcfoij]{border-bottom:1px solid var(--line);padding:.7rem 0}details[data-astro-cid-hmgcfoij]:last-of-type{border-bottom:none}details[data-astro-cid-hmgcfoij] summary[data-astro-cid-hmgcfoij]{cursor:pointer;font-weight:600;font-family:Space Grotesk,system-ui,sans-serif;color:var(--text);list-style:none;display:flex;align-items:center;gap:.5rem}details[data-astro-cid-hmgcfoij] summary[data-astro-cid-hmgcfoij]:before{content:"+";display:inline-flex;align-items:center;justify-content:center;width:1.4rem;height:1.4rem;border-radius:.4rem;background:color-mix(in oklab,var(--accent) 15%,transparent);color:var(--accent);font-size:1.1rem;flex-shrink:0}details[data-astro-cid-hmgcfoij][open] summary[data-astro-cid-hmgcfoij]:before{content:"−"}details[data-astro-cid-hmgcfoij] summary[data-astro-cid-hmgcfoij]::-webkit-details-marker{display:none}details[data-astro-cid-hmgcfoij] p[data-astro-cid-hmgcfoij]{margin:.5rem 0 0 1.9rem;color:var(--muted);line-height:1.6}details[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]{color:var(--accent);text-decoration:none}details[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:hover,details[data-astro-cid-hmgcfoij] a[data-astro-cid-hmgcfoij]:focus-visible{text-decoration:underline}@media(max-width:900px){.quarter-grid[data-astro-cid-hmgcfoij]{grid-template-columns:1fr}}
